Md. Code, Insurance § 15–101

This title does not apply to:

(1) a policy of liability or workers’ compensation and employer’s liability insurance;

(2) a group or blanket policy, except as otherwise provided in this title;

(3) reinsurance; or

(4) a life insurance, endowment, or annuity contract, or contract supplemental to a life insurance, endowment, or annuity contract that contains only those provisions relating to health insurance that:

(i) provide additional benefits in case of dismemberment, loss of sight, or death by accident or accidental means;

(ii) provide additional benefits for long-term home health care and long-term care in a nursing home or other related institution; or

(iii) operate to safeguard the contract or supplemental contract against lapse or to provide a special surrender value, special benefit, or annuity in the event that the insured or annuitant becomes totally and permanently disabled, as defined by the contract or supplemental contract.
